    Understanding the Cost of Towing

    Before diving into finding a cheap towing service, it's crucial to understand the factors influencing the final price. Towing costs aren't uniform; they vary based on several key elements:

    • Distance: The further your vehicle needs to be towed, the higher the cost will be. This is often calculated per mile.
    • Vehicle Type: Towing a small car is cheaper than towing a large truck or an RV. The size and weight of the vehicle directly impact the resources required for towing.
    • Type of Tow: Different towing methods exist, each with varying costs. Wheel-lift towing is generally cheaper than flatbed towing, but flatbed towing is safer for vehicles with mechanical issues.
    • Time of Day/Week: Emergency towing services often charge higher rates during nights, weekends, and holidays due to increased demand.
    • Additional Services: If you need additional services like fuel delivery, tire changes, or lockout assistance, expect to pay extra.
    • Location: Urban areas tend to have higher towing costs than rural areas due to factors like traffic congestion and higher operational expenses.

    Finding Reputable Cheap Towing Services

    The quest for a cheap towing service shouldn't compromise safety or reliability. Here’s how to find a balance between cost and quality:

    • Online Searches: Start with a simple online search for "cheap towing service near me." Pay close attention to online reviews and ratings on platforms like Google My Business, Yelp, and other review sites. Look for consistent positive feedback regarding pricing, responsiveness, and professionalism.
    • Check Local Directories: Explore local business directories and online yellow pages. These resources often list towing companies in your area, allowing you to compare prices and services.
    • Ask for Recommendations: Reach out to friends, family, neighbors, or colleagues. Personal recommendations can be invaluable in finding a trustworthy and affordable towing service.
    • Compare Multiple Quotes: Never settle for the first quote you receive. Contact at least three different towing companies to compare their prices and services. Be sure to provide them with the same information (vehicle type, location, destination) for accurate comparison.
    • Verify Licensing and Insurance: Ensure the towing company is properly licensed and insured. This protects you in case of accidents or damages during the towing process. You can usually find this information on their website or by contacting your local regulatory authority.

    Negotiating the Price

    While aiming for a cheap towing service, remember that aggressive negotiation can sometimes backfire. However, polite and respectful negotiation can often lead to a better price.

    • Be upfront about your budget: Let the towing company know your budget constraints early in the conversation. This helps them tailor their quote to your financial capabilities.
    • Inquire about discounts: Many towing companies offer discounts for AAA members, senior citizens, or military personnel. Don't hesitate to ask.
    • Negotiate the distance: If the towing distance is flexible, discuss the possibility of shortening the distance to lower the overall cost. For example, if you can arrange for your car to be towed to a closer repair shop, it might save you money.
    • Bundle services: If you need multiple services (e.g., towing and jump start), inquire about bundled discounts. Often, combining services can lead to a lower overall price.
    • Pay attention to hidden fees: Before agreeing to the price, carefully review the quote for any hidden fees or additional charges. Clarify any ambiguities to avoid unexpected costs.

    What to Expect During the Towing Process

    Once you've chosen a towing service, understanding the process can alleviate stress and ensure a smoother experience.

    • Confirmation and Arrival Time: Confirm the appointment details, including the estimated arrival time. Reputable companies will provide an accurate timeframe.
    • Driver Identification: Ensure the driver presents proper identification and company credentials before allowing them to tow your vehicle.
    • Vehicle Inspection: Before the tow begins, it's advisable to take photos and videos of your vehicle's condition to document its state before towing. This helps prevent disputes regarding pre-existing damages.
    • Towing Method: Understand the towing method being used (wheel-lift or flatbed) and ensure it's appropriate for your vehicle's condition.
    • Payment Method: Clarify the payment method accepted by the towing company. Confirm the final price before payment to avoid any discrepancies.
    • Receipt and Documentation: Upon completion, obtain a receipt detailing the services rendered and the payment made. This document serves as proof of service.

    Choosing Between Wheel-Lift and Flatbed Towing

    The choice between wheel-lift and flatbed towing significantly impacts cost and vehicle safety.

    • Wheel-lift Towing: This method lifts the front or rear wheels of the vehicle, leaving the other wheels on the ground. It's generally cheaper than flatbed towing but carries a higher risk of damage, especially for vehicles with transmission or suspension problems.
    • Flatbed Towing: This method uses a flatbed trailer to securely transport the entire vehicle. It's safer and better protects the vehicle from damage, but it's typically more expensive.

    Consider your vehicle's condition. If your car is drivable but needs to be towed, wheel-lift might suffice. However, if your vehicle has significant mechanical issues, flatbed towing is the safer and recommended option, despite the higher cost.

    Emergency Towing Services vs. Non-Emergency Services

    The urgency of your situation dictates the type of service you need.

    • Emergency Towing Services: These services operate 24/7 and are designed to handle immediate roadside emergencies. Expect to pay a premium for their immediate availability and round-the-clock service.
    • Non-Emergency Towing Services: These services offer towing at scheduled times, typically during regular business hours. They generally offer lower prices than emergency services.

    Tips for Preventing Future Towing Situations

    Proactive measures can significantly reduce the chances of needing a towing service in the future.

    • Regular Vehicle Maintenance: Regular maintenance checks prevent many mechanical breakdowns that lead to towing.
    • Emergency Kit: Keep a well-stocked emergency kit in your vehicle, including jumper cables, a tire pressure gauge, a spare tire, and basic tools.
    • Roadside Assistance: Consider subscribing to a roadside assistance program like AAA. These programs often offer towing services at significantly reduced rates or even for free.
    • Monitor Warning Lights: Pay attention to your vehicle's warning lights and address any issues promptly to avoid serious problems down the line.

    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

    Q: How can I find a licensed and insured towing company?

    A: Check the company's website or contact your local regulatory authority to verify their licensing and insurance status. Many reputable companies will display their license information prominently.

    Q: What information should I provide when requesting a towing quote?

    A: Provide the make, model, and year of your vehicle, your current location, your destination (repair shop or home), and any additional services required.

    Q: Can I negotiate the price even after the service is completed?

    A: While it's less likely to succeed, you can try negotiating the price after the service, particularly if unforeseen issues arose. However, this is less likely to work than negotiating beforehand.

    Q: What should I do if I suspect overcharging?

    A: If you believe you have been overcharged, review your contract and the quote carefully. Contact the company to discuss your concerns and request a detailed breakdown of charges. If the issue remains unresolved, you may need to seek further assistance from consumer protection agencies.

    Q: Are there any hidden costs I should be aware of?

    A: Be wary of hidden fees like after-hours surcharges, mileage overages, and additional charges for services not explicitly stated in the initial quote. Always confirm everything before agreeing to the service.
